The Story of U-995
                        DVD-4

 

This tape tells the story of this, the ONLY Type VII-C  left in the world through her time in the Kriegsmarine in WW II, to the Norwegian Navy where she was known as KAURA and to her final site as a memorial on the shores of the Baltic Sea.  The story is told by her last Skipper, Oblt HANS-GEORG HESS (KNIGHTS CROSS) who, at barely 21 years of age, became the youngest combat submarine Skipper of WW II, possibly of all time. Lots of good footage - combat, training and current day.
                          
Run time is 47 minutes
